麻豆黑色丝袜jk制服福利网站-麻豆精品传媒视频观看-麻豆精品传媒一二三区在线视频-麻豆精选传媒4区2021-在线视频99-在线视频a

千鋒教育-做有情懷、有良心、有品質(zhì)的職業(yè)教育機(jī)構(gòu)

手機(jī)站
千鋒教育

千鋒學(xué)習(xí)站 | 隨時(shí)隨地免費(fèi)學(xué)

千鋒教育

掃一掃進(jìn)入千鋒手機(jī)站

領(lǐng)取全套視頻
千鋒教育

關(guān)注千鋒學(xué)習(xí)站小程序
隨時(shí)隨地免費(fèi)學(xué)習(xí)課程

當(dāng)前位置:首頁(yè)  >  技術(shù)干貨  > python len()函數(shù)

python len()函數(shù)

來(lái)源:千鋒教育
發(fā)布人:xqq
時(shí)間: 2024-01-11 15:26:11 1704957971

**Python len()函數(shù)及其應(yīng)用**

**Python len()函數(shù)簡(jiǎn)介**

在Python編程語(yǔ)言中,len()函數(shù)是一個(gè)內(nèi)置函數(shù),用于返回給定對(duì)象的長(zhǎng)度或元素的個(gè)數(shù)。它可以用于字符串、列表、元組、字典、集合等各種數(shù)據(jù)類型。len()函數(shù)的語(yǔ)法如下:

len(object)

其中,object是要計(jì)算長(zhǎng)度的對(duì)象。下面將詳細(xì)介紹len()函數(shù)的應(yīng)用以及一些常見(jiàn)問(wèn)題的解答。

**len()函數(shù)的應(yīng)用**

1. **字符串長(zhǎng)度計(jì)算**

len()函數(shù)可以用來(lái)計(jì)算字符串的長(zhǎng)度,即字符串中字符的個(gè)數(shù)。下面是一個(gè)示例:

`python

string = "Hello, World!"

length = len(string)

print("字符串的長(zhǎng)度為:", length)

輸出結(jié)果為:

字符串的長(zhǎng)度為: 13

2. **列表長(zhǎng)度計(jì)算**

len()函數(shù)同樣適用于列表,可以用來(lái)計(jì)算列表中元素的個(gè)數(shù)。下面是一個(gè)示例:

`python

list = [1, 2, 3, 4, 5]

length = len(list)

print("列表的長(zhǎng)度為:", length)

輸出結(jié)果為:

列表的長(zhǎng)度為: 5

3. **字典長(zhǎng)度計(jì)算**

對(duì)于字典,len()函數(shù)可以用來(lái)計(jì)算字典中鍵值對(duì)的個(gè)數(shù)。下面是一個(gè)示例:

`python

dict = {"name": "John", "age": 25, "city": "New York"}

length = len(dict)

print("字典的長(zhǎng)度為:", length)

輸出結(jié)果為:

字典的長(zhǎng)度為: 3

4. **集合長(zhǎng)度計(jì)算**

len()函數(shù)還可以用來(lái)計(jì)算集合中元素的個(gè)數(shù)。下面是一個(gè)示例:

`python

set = {1, 2, 3, 4, 5}

length = len(set)

print("集合的長(zhǎng)度為:", length)

輸出結(jié)果為:

集合的長(zhǎng)度為: 5

5. **其他數(shù)據(jù)類型的長(zhǎng)度計(jì)算**

除了字符串、列表、字典和集合,len()函數(shù)還可以用于其他數(shù)據(jù)類型的長(zhǎng)度計(jì)算,如元組、文件等。下面是一個(gè)示例:

`python

tuple = (1, 2, 3, 4, 5)

length = len(tuple)

print("元組的長(zhǎng)度為:", length)

輸出結(jié)果為:

元組的長(zhǎng)度為: 5

**關(guān)于len()函數(shù)的常見(jiàn)問(wèn)題解答**

1. **len()函數(shù)是否適用于自定義數(shù)據(jù)類型?**

是的,len()函數(shù)適用于自定義數(shù)據(jù)類型。如果在自定義類中定義了__len__()方法,len()函數(shù)就可以用于計(jì)算該類的長(zhǎng)度。

2. **len()函數(shù)是否可以用于計(jì)算多維數(shù)據(jù)結(jié)構(gòu)的長(zhǎng)度?**

是的,len()函數(shù)可以用于計(jì)算多維數(shù)據(jù)結(jié)構(gòu)的長(zhǎng)度。例如,可以用len()函數(shù)計(jì)算二維列表中每個(gè)子列表的長(zhǎng)度。

3. **len()函數(shù)是否可以用于計(jì)算空對(duì)象的長(zhǎng)度?**

是的,len()函數(shù)可以用于計(jì)算空對(duì)象的長(zhǎng)度。對(duì)于空字符串、空列表、空字典等空對(duì)象,len()函數(shù)返回的結(jié)果為0。

4. **len()函數(shù)是否可以用于計(jì)算字符串的字節(jié)數(shù)?**

是的,len()函數(shù)可以用于計(jì)算字符串的字節(jié)數(shù)。在Python 3中,字符串的長(zhǎng)度計(jì)算是根據(jù)字符的個(gè)數(shù)來(lái)進(jìn)行的,而不是根據(jù)字節(jié)數(shù)。

5. **len()函數(shù)是否可以用于計(jì)算文件的長(zhǎng)度?**

len()函數(shù)無(wú)法直接用于計(jì)算文件的長(zhǎng)度。如果要計(jì)算文件的長(zhǎng)度,可以使用os模塊中的os.path.getsize()函數(shù)。

**總結(jié)**

我們了解了Python中l(wèi)en()函數(shù)的基本用法及其在字符串、列表、字典、集合等數(shù)據(jù)類型中的應(yīng)用。我們還解答了一些關(guān)于len()函數(shù)的常見(jiàn)問(wèn)題。len()函數(shù)是Python編程中非常常用的一個(gè)函數(shù),掌握它的用法對(duì)于處理數(shù)據(jù)長(zhǎng)度和元素個(gè)數(shù)的計(jì)算非常有幫助。希望本文能對(duì)您理解和使用len()函數(shù)有所幫助。

tags: python字典
聲明:本站稿件版權(quán)均屬千鋒教育所有,未經(jīng)許可不得擅自轉(zhuǎn)載。
10年以上業(yè)內(nèi)強(qiáng)師集結(jié),手把手帶你蛻變精英
請(qǐng)您保持通訊暢通,專屬學(xué)習(xí)老師24小時(shí)內(nèi)將與您1V1溝通
免費(fèi)領(lǐng)取
今日已有369人領(lǐng)取成功
劉同學(xué) 138****2860 剛剛成功領(lǐng)取
王同學(xué) 131****2015 剛剛成功領(lǐng)取
張同學(xué) 133****4652 剛剛成功領(lǐng)取
李同學(xué) 135****8607 剛剛成功領(lǐng)取
楊同學(xué) 132****5667 剛剛成功領(lǐng)取
岳同學(xué) 134****6652 剛剛成功領(lǐng)取
梁同學(xué) 157****2950 剛剛成功領(lǐng)取
劉同學(xué) 189****1015 剛剛成功領(lǐng)取
張同學(xué) 155****4678 剛剛成功領(lǐng)取
鄒同學(xué) 139****2907 剛剛成功領(lǐng)取
董同學(xué) 138****2867 剛剛成功領(lǐng)取
周同學(xué) 136****3602 剛剛成功領(lǐng)取
相關(guān)推薦HOT
python list用法

Python中的list是一種非常常用的數(shù)據(jù)類型,它可以存儲(chǔ)任意類型的數(shù)據(jù),并且可以動(dòng)態(tài)地?cái)U(kuò)展和縮小。在Python中,list是一個(gè)有序的集合,每個(gè)元素...詳情>>

2024-01-11 15:27:11
python length函數(shù)

**Python length函數(shù):探索字符串和列表的長(zhǎng)度****Python**是一種功能強(qiáng)大且易于學(xué)習(xí)的編程語(yǔ)言,它提供了許多內(nèi)置函數(shù)來(lái)幫助我們處理和操作數(shù)...詳情>>

2024-01-11 15:26:40
python isspace函數(shù)

Python isspace函數(shù)詳解及相關(guān)問(wèn)答Python是一門高級(jí)編程語(yǔ)言,它的語(yǔ)法簡(jiǎn)潔易懂,非常適合初學(xué)者學(xué)習(xí)。Python內(nèi)置了許多有用的函數(shù),其中之一就...詳情>>

2024-01-11 15:24:10
python isnull函數(shù)

Python中的isnull函數(shù)是一個(gè)非常有用的函數(shù),它可以幫助我們判斷一個(gè)值是否為空。在編程中,我們經(jīng)常需要處理各種數(shù)據(jù),有時(shí)候這些數(shù)據(jù)可能會(huì)存...詳情>>

2024-01-11 15:24:10
python isnan函數(shù)

Python isnan函數(shù)是一個(gè)非常有用的函數(shù),它可以判斷一個(gè)變量是否為NaN(Not a Number)類型。NaN類型是一種特殊的數(shù)字類型,它表示一個(gè)非數(shù)值的...詳情>>

2024-01-11 15:23:40
主站蜘蛛池模板: 国产精品亚洲片在线花蝴蝶| 进进出出稚嫩娇小狭窄| 在线播放真实国产乱子伦| 欧美不卡影院| 里番牝教师~淫辱yy608| 日本免费观看网站| 美国式禁忌免费看| 99热在线看| 国产破处在线| 夜夜影院未满十八勿进| 久久精品国产色蜜蜜麻豆| 91香蕉国产线观看免| 久久精品国产欧美日韩99热 | eeuss影院在线观看| 好紧我太爽了视频免费国产| 高清视频一区二区三区| 女神校花乳环调教| 看一级毛片| 欧美老少配性视频播放| 欧美高清hd| 日日干影院| 在线免费h视频| 国产精品成人va在线观看 | 一个人hd高清在线观看| 51神马午夜| 18女人毛片大全| 一个人hd高清在线观看| 久久我们这里只有精品国产4| 亚洲国产日韩在线人成蜜芽 | 免费一级黄色录像影片| 好色先生tv网站| 国产系列在线播放| 2018国产大陆天天弄| 久久夜色精品国产噜噜亚洲a| 日韩大片在线| 亚洲国产精品久久网午夜| 看看镜子里我怎么玩你| 99久久精品免费看国产一区二区三区| 国产精品伦理一二三区伦理| 国产精品免费看久久久| 在线看福利影|